A local theatre company is set to perform an open-air Shakespeare play in the Villa Marina Gardens next week.
Parodos Theatre Company is taking on 'The Merchant of Venice' from September 7-9.
The venue has historically hosted outdoor performances in the past, but not in recent times.
Producer Charlie Williams says people are wanting to see the space used, and this could create more options for other theatre companies:
Audiences are invited to bring along rugs, blankets and chairs to enjoy the show on the grass, and a bar service will be available before and during the interval of each performance.
